Hi All:

I've finally arrived in Edinburgh and beginning to look into getting a mobile (we already have a land-line). There seems to be an incredible amount of providers/companies out there, does anyone have any advice or insight on who we should go with, fine print cautions etc?

The big companies are Orange, Vodafone, O2 (sure there's a couple others I can't think of).

Do you want pay as you go or a contract? I've been on pay as you go for 8 years - you can get pretty cheap handsets now and I don't make enough phone calls to warrant £30 a month. A couple things that are different from Canada here - one, your money doesn't expire on your phone (in Canada, you have to top up the pay as you go every month or lose all the money), and you don't get charged for incoming calls.

If you have some friends you'll want to call, find out what networks they are on - it is always more expensive to call another network. That's the reason I went with Orange, because all my friends are on it. However, the other important thing is coverage - unfortunately some networks are good in some areas and some are good in others. My Orange phone does not work very well in my flat, but my (work) Vodafone one does. But I have been other places where Orange works and Vodafone doesn't. So you may want to ask people around you what they are using. But I never had problems in Edinburgh with coverage.
